Trump: US interest rates should be 1% or lower

Trump's Truth Social latest posts
5小時前

President Donald Trump posted on X on September 16, calling for U.S. interest rates to be 1% or lower, arguing that the country has the best credit in the world, "BY FAR." He claimed the nation is "BOOMING with new Investment" and that if the U.S. stopped trading with every country it has a deficit with—which is most of them—it would make at least $1.5 trillion a year. Trump dismissed the term "deficit" as "nothing more than a fancy word for LOSS," and asserted that the U.S. is "carrying" almost every country in the world, a situation he says cannot continue. He concluded the post with an urgent demand: "LOWER THE INTEREST RATES FOR THE UNITED STATES OF AMERICA, AND FAST!"

The president's remarks reflect his long-standing criticism of the Federal Reserve's monetary policy. The current federal funds rate target range stands at 5.25% to 5.5%.
